    I tried this on a mini hammock I am making out of bug netting that I am going to use as a gear loft. I pulled the exposed end of the hammock and the hammock body in different directions, and the knot came undone. Did I do something wrong when tying the knot, or is this just the nature of that knot?
    Don't know for sure but my guess is you didn't tie the knot correctly. It seems to be one of those knots where people find variations that don't work well. There are at least 2 variations I have seen to mess it up.

    I tried it with some rope, and it worked fine. I think what I did differently was to keep the knot close to the bend in the rope, so it cinches up tight around the bend. I will give it another shot!
